May 3, 2019 · When you’re an employee, you pay 7.65% in Social Security and Medicare tax, and your employer pays the other 7.65%. When you’re self-employed, you pay the full 15.3%, in what is known as “self-employment tax.”. Only the first $128,400 of self-employment income is eligible for taxation at the full 15.3% tax rate. Dec 21, 2023 · QuickBooks Self-Employed can automatically calculate quarterly tax estimates based on income and expenses tracked in the software. This eliminates the need to manually calculate estimated taxes each quarter. Specifically, QuickBooks Self-Employed will: Track all business income and expenses. Download all your work from QuickBooks Self-Employed so you have an extra copy for safekeeping. Go to Reports. From the Tax details section, select a tax year. Select Download. Download a report for each year you have in QuickBooks. Repeat these steps for your Profit and Loss, Mileage Log, and Receipts.Find a transaction on the list. The QuickBooks Online mobile app works with iPhone, iPad, and Android phones and tablets.Dec 1, 2022 · QuickBooks Self-Employed only tracks your income and expenses from your self-employed work. Since it needs your tax bracket info to calculate your federal estimated quarterly tax payments, you need to fill out a tax profile. This gives QuickBooks your complete tax info so your estimates are accurate.Intuit now offers NAR members exciting discounts on QuickBooks® Self-Employed and select TurboTax® products, through the REALTOR Benefits® Program. www ...Aug 12, 2016 ... At $15 a month, QuickBooks Self-Employed is at the higher end of freelance accounting software. Most of QuickBooks’ main competitors charge less: Zoho Books is free for businesses with less than $50K in annual revenue, Xero starts at $12 a month, and Wave Accounting is completely free..
